Wait, So Luxembourg Is Actually Decent? Plus Other European Minnows On The Ascent

Luxembourg is rarely a country that is mentioned in discussions of European football. A victory over the Republic of Ireland and a good performance against Portugal during World Cup qualifiers back in March made a few headlines, but few people outside of Luxembourg understand how far football has come in the country in the last decade.

Mexico's Bottle-Throwing Shenanigans Are Nothing New, But The Instant Karma Never Gets Old

If there's one takeaway from last night's CONCACAF Nations League final, it's that the USMNT vs. Mexico rivalry is alive and well.

The first competitive match between the North American rivals since the 2019 Gold Cup Final had everything: late equalizers, abundant yellow cards, penalties, missed penalties, VAR controversy, on-field scuffles and inexplicably long periods of injury.
